Why This Matters

Reliable emergency communications save lives.
In disasters, crowded venues, or indoor spaces where cellular signals fail, Wi-Fi has proven to be a critical safety net. With Wi-Fi 6/7, Passpoint® and OpenRoaming™, the industry can now extend emergency services seamlessly across millions of access points worldwide.


These reports define the technical, operational, and regulatory frameworks that make Wi-Fi a trusted part of the global emergency communications ecosystem.
The reports also demonstrate how enhanced mission critical communication services can be delivered for emergency services personnel, ensuring robust two-way communications in large operations such as disaster recovery and crowd control.

Get Involved in the Next Phase

The WBA Mission Critical & Emergency Services Program is driving the next stage of development, including:

  • Enhancing 3GPP and IEEE standards for Wi-Fi location in emergency contexts
  • Expanding interoperability testing across device makers and network providers
  • Working with regulators to define liability, privacy, and compliance frameworks
  • Developing best practices for scaling deployment across enterprises, municipalities, and operators
